Quite enjoying Axiom Verge too. Not sure how far I am, it's a little wandery for my tastes but it's certainly good fun. Like the NES aesthetic mixed with modern effect sensibilities. It looks better on a 1080p screen though - the various unusual areas that zoom out or apply a scanline effect are rendered 1:1 there rather than on the handheld.
